Responsibilities
What You’ll Do
Supports the Director in overseeing the development of electronic submissions to ensure measurement results are accurately prepared and submitted electronically. Coordinates the development of educational programs to orient hospital staff to quality measurement goals and objectives, including key components of Performance Improvement and Patient Safety initiatives. Promotes a strong commitment to quality healthcare, patient satisfaction, education, and research in alignment with the hospital's mission and goals. Ensures staff are properly trained and regularly evaluated on their understanding of, and adherence to, job-specific compliance policies and procedures Oversees the integration of chart abstraction and data analytics to support quality measurement and performance improvement initiatives. Designs, implements, and oversees a formal data collection system to deliver comprehensive statistical reports to clinical and hospital departments.
Qualifications
What You’ll Bring
Required
Bachelor’s Degree in a health care related field, Public Health, Business Administration or a related field required. A Master’s Degree preferred. Bachelor’s Degree, CPHQ or CPPS At least five (5) years of quality improvement and/or analytics experience, including three (3) years at a progressively responsible management/leadership level, required. Certified Professional in Healthcare Quality or Certified Professional in Patient Safety required. Excellent interpersonal and written communication skills with a demonstrated ability to orally relate complex information in a reliable fashion to both leadership and governance as well as general staff members and the medical staff. Must demonstrate a strong orientation to customer satisfaction, effective teamwork, problem solving and utilize small group dynamics in conflict management. Strong background in statistical process control and/or other quality improvement and measurement techniques necessary. Computer literacy required. Additional related experience may be substituted for the Master’s Degree on a year‐for‐year basis.

About Us
University Hospital is one of the nation’s leading academic medical centers. As the principal teaching affiliate of Rutgers New Jersey Medical School and the only state-certified Level 1 Trauma Center in Northern New Jersey, University Hospital is training the next generation of physicians and advancing science to discovery while taking exceptional care of patients, regardless of their financial situation.
